"Pacifics 824 and 850 had their boilers lifted, they were life expired.

Wisarut Bholsithi reports that repairs have commenced and the locomotives should be ready for the 5th December 2012 train.

The two locos hauled a test train to Nakhon Pathom yesterday (November 4th).

According to a senior manager at Thonburi Depot, their overhaul included the fitting of new boilers which were made in Thailand to Japanese specification....."
